Confirm the Light Really Is the Problem

Deciding that an aquarium light too bright for fish is the cause of some behaviour change is easy to do and frequently wrong. Fish hide for several different reasons, and only one of them is intensity, so take all the readings first before dimming anything or rearranging the whole tank.

The decisive numbers to record before acting

Start with four water readings: ammonia, nitrite, nitrate and temperature. Ammonia and nitrite belong at 0 ppm and nitrate below 20–40 ppm, with temperature inside the range your species needs, because fish under ammonia stress hide in ways that look convincingly like light avoidance.

Then record the lighting itself: the scheduled hours, whether the fixture is dimmable, its height above the water line, and an honest estimate of the daylight reaching the tank. A window-side tank can receive several hours of ambient light beyond whatever the timer is actually set to.

Behaviour that points at intensity rather than water

Light-related behaviour is consistent and strongly positional. Fish shelter under hardscape or in shaded corners throughout the lit period, emerge visibly once the light goes off, and feed more confidently in the evening than during the day, which is the clearest single indicator.

Colour tells you something useful too. Many species pale under bright open conditions as a stress response, and shy species from shaded habitats, including many tetras, loaches and catfish, show it most obviously because they evolved under heavy canopy and in tannin-stained water.

When it is not the light at all

New fish will hide for days regardless of the lighting, and that settling period is entirely normal rather than a problem to be solved. Judge behaviour only after a week or two in the tank, since acting within the first few days almost always leads to changes that were never actually needed.

An open layout is the other frequent cause here. A tank with no plants, no caves and no shaded areas leaves the fish exposed at almost any intensity, and adding cover often resolves the behaviour completely without touching the fixture or shortening the photoperiod at all in the end.

Reducing the Intensity, in Order of Safety

Once the readings confirm an aquarium light too bright for fish, work upward from the cheapest and most reversible change first. Adding shade costs nothing and helps the tank in other ways, whereas cutting the photoperiod back too far starts to affect the plants long before it helps the fish.

Step one: add cover and shade before touching the fixture

Floating plants are the single most effective fix of all, because they diffuse light exactly where it enters and give fish a shaded canopy that mirrors their natural habitat. Duckweed, frogbit and salvinia all work well, though duckweed spreads fast enough to become a chore in itself.

Hardscape then does the rest of the work for you. Caves, driftwood and taller planting create shaded zones that let the fish choose their own comfort level, which is more effective than any single intensity setting, because different species in the same tank prefer quite different conditions.

Step two: dim the fixture or raise it

If the light is dimmable, reduce it in steps of roughly twenty percent and then hold each setting for a week or two before judging it. If it is not dimmable, raising the fixture a few inches (several cm) on its legs reduces intensity at the substrate noticeably and costs you nothing.

Ramping helps separately from raw intensity. A fixture that rises over twenty or thirty minutes rather than switching on abruptly does visibly settle fish, and where the fixture has no ramp function at all, switching on a room light first achieves a rough version of the same effect.

Step three: tank size, placement and physical fit

The position of the tank matters as much as the fixture. A tank away from windows holds a predictable light budget, whereas one on a sunny sill receives far more than the timer suggests, and moving it into a more shaded part of the room often resolves the problem entirely on its own.

Weight decides whether moving the tank is realistic at all: a full tank runs near 10 lb per gallon (about 1 kg per L), so a 55 gallon (208 L) setup passes 600 lb (272 kg) and must be drained first. Measure the new position and the stand with a tape before ordering or moving anything.

What Never to Do When Reducing Light

Three common responses to an aquarium light too bright for fish all tend to create new problems while solving the original one. Each of them looks like a reasonable shortcut, and each either harms the plants, confuses the diagnosis, or leaves the tank in a worse state than it started in.

Never cut the photoperiod below about five hours

Shortening the hours reduces the total light budget, but below roughly five or six hours the plants begin to suffer visibly while the fish gain very little, since it is the intensity during the lit period rather than its overall length that determines how exposed the fish actually feel.

Dim the light or add shade instead. Reducing intensity while keeping a normal six to eight hour period gives the fish darker conditions right through the day and keeps the plants supplied, which is precisely the outcome that the photoperiod approach fails to achieve at any setting.

Never change several things in the same week

Dimming the light, adding floating plants and rearranging the hardscape all at once leaves you unable to tell which change actually helped. Make one adjustment at a time, wait a week or two, and note down what happens, because fish behaviour also settles on its own over that same span.

Exactly the same principle applies to any stocking changes. Adding new fish during any lighting trial confuses the picture completely, since new arrivals hide for days regardless, and their behaviour is very easily misread as evidence that the lighting adjustment did or did not work.

Never leave the tank dark to compensate

Running the tank unlit for several days does not help the fish and actively harms the plants, which will begin to deteriorate within about a week. Fish need a normal day and night cycle, and extended darkness is a stressor in its own right rather than a rest from an over-bright fixture.

The same logic applies to switching the light on only when you happen to be watching. Irregular lighting is the single most common cause of algae in otherwise well-kept tanks, and it gives fish no predictable pattern to settle into, which is the opposite of what a nervous species needs.

Keeping the Balance Right Over Time

Once the tank is comfortable again, the settings that first fixed an aquarium light too bright for fish still need occasional review, because the plants grow, floating cover spreads or dies back, and the daylight reaching the tank changes considerably between winter and midsummer.

A review routine that catches drift

Watch the fish during the lit period at least once a week, rather than only at feeding time. Confident use of open water throughout the day is the clearest sign that the balance is right, and a gradual retreat back into cover is the earliest warning sign that something has changed.

Thin the floating plants before they cover the entire surface. A complete mat blocks so much light that rooted plants below begin to fail, and gas exchange at the surface is reduced, so keeping coverage to roughly half or two thirds of the surface is the usual balance to aim for.

What changes and how it shows up

Daylight is by far the largest seasonal variable. Daylight hours stretch out considerably from late spring into midsummer, so a window-side tank that suited its fish perfectly well through winter can become uncomfortably bright by June without anyone touching the fixture or the timer.

LED output declines slowly across the years, which works in exactly the opposite direction. A fixture that was too bright when new may sit comfortably by its fourth or fifth year, at which point the floating cover added earlier can start to leave the whole tank genuinely underlit.

Early warning signs and the twelve month cost

An aquarium light too bright for fish usually announces itself through three signals: fish retreating to cover in the day, colours fading in species that were bright before, and feeding shifting to the evening. Any one of them means the balance has drifted and is worth checking before reaching for a different fixture.

Frequently Asked Questions

These questions come up constantly once people start treating fish behaviour as useful evidence rather than as a final verdict, because an aquarium light too bright for fish, a tank with poor water quality, and a tank with no cover all produce remarkably similar symptoms day to day.

Which fish are most sensitive to bright light?

Species from shaded, tannin-stained waters generally, which includes many tetras, loaches, catfish and plecos. They evolved under heavy canopy and behave accordingly, whereas many livebearers and rainbowfish come from open sunlit waters and are visibly untroubled by the brightness.

Do floating plants really help?

Yes, and more so than almost any other single change. They diffuse light where it enters, provide overhead cover that fish read as safety, and consume nutrients that would otherwise feed algae, so they address several problems with one inexpensive and entirely reversible addition.

Should I use a dim blue light at night?

There is no real benefit at all for the fish, which need genuine darkness in order to rest. Blue night lighting is really for the owner rather than for the tank, and if it is used at all it should be brief, since a continuous light period of any colour is a stressor rather than a comfort.

How long before I know a change has worked?

Allow a full one to two weeks. Fish adjust only gradually, and their behaviour settles on its own over a broadly similar span, so judging after only two or three days risks attributing a perfectly normal settling pattern to whatever adjustment you happened to make just before it.

Conclusion

An aquarium light too bright for fish is best confirmed against water readings and the tank layout before anything is changed, since ammonia stress and an open tank produce the same hiding behaviour. Rule both of those out first, and then add shade before touching the fixture at all.
